    Microsoft Publisher Finishing issues

    I have seen this same problem on 2 different machines in the last couple of weeks ..when using publisher and trying to do booklets the machine will only do one booklet properly...if you select more than one copy it will print them all together and staple them as one booklet ...I have played around with all the collate driver settings could not get either of them to work...however once the document (in both cases) was converted to a PDF I could get it to print properly, no problems. The first machine was a C450 the second a C253, both with saddle stitchers...anyone else seen or resolved this issue?

    I've seen something similar on Copystar machines. The page images were consistently mis-registered or overlapped on pgs 3 & 4 of the booklet from Publisher 2007.

    My solution was to upgrade the print driver to a newer version, but you may have good results from downgrading to an older driver, or maybe using a universal driver. It makes sense to hold onto the older versions of the print drivers. Along the same lines, I'm not in a such big hurry to rush around and upgrade functioning print drivers. It's a good way to create problems where there are none, yet...

    Newer is not necessarily better. Whenever possible I like to try out new drivers & firmware in my office before taking them out to the customer.

    You say that you have played with the collate settings within the driver, but have you turned the collate setting off in the Publisher Print dialog box?

    Collate.JPG

    Turn off the collate option that you can see in this image marked with red. The Publisher Print dialog box might look a little different as this is from Word, but the same principal.
